    Are you looking for a 2500 series or 8500 series? The 2500 series are older and look, in my opinion, slightly more dressed up than the 8500 series. Regardless, for a really high end, used example I think you are going to need more than the current $2,000 budget. Of course, if you would like a quartz example then you may be able to get one within your budget. Good luck.

    Be patient. The quartz version of the modern and older aqua terras are routinely available on ebay for under $2K.

    An auto version under $2K is possible though a little harder to find. Your best bet is the 36mm version if you really want auto. The smaller diamter ones usually go for a little less $$.

    Chances for a silver 1st gen AT are pretty good. Need a little luck at $2K.

    Blue however, not so much. For some reason BLUE 1st gen AT's (autos and quartz) are harder to find and go even quicker. In 6 months 1 only found 1 2503.80, and it sold in 1 day:

    If you want to buy a cal 8500, I suggest you try it on before purchase. I bought one on the forum without actually seeing one in person, and I found it wore very thick on my wrist and ultimately didn't work for me. It is such a handsome watch in photographs but somehow didn't seem as attractive in the metal.
